Charlee, it really doesn't matter how old you are. I have noticed some really young looking women in my clinic. You have to be assertive when you go to see your gp. Demand an appointment at the hospital. They will do a series of blood tests on you and your partner. The results from this will take about 6 weeks. It'll probably take you about 3mths to get a first appointment. Start the ball rolling now. The NHS won't offer you anything unless you ask.
Good luck

By the way have you been to the EPU for a scan just to check whats going on. It seems to me that you have bled for a short time only. I have always bled/passed clots for about 2weeks.
It's worth a check.
